Description

The practical format of this text allows native Spanish-speakers studying English to compare and contrast the grammar of both languages at a glance. Explanations are presented in Spanish, with examples in both Spanish and English. The trouble spots for the Spanish-speaker learning English are featured, as are the problematic two-word verbs in English.

This systematic, comparative approach facilitates students' understanding of forms and structures in both languages and allows them to build on what they already know. Lessons organized by parts of speech explain functions and uses in clear language with abundant examples. Students focus on and thoroughly understand each grammar concept--while learning the grammar of their own language! Vocabulary is limited to frequently used words, which helps intermediate students concentrate more on structure. A Quick Check summarizes main ideas in each section and provides models.
